PN10 ZST is a 2010 Volkswagen Tiguan in Black with a 1,968c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 71.4%.
Across all 2010 Volkswagen Tiguan models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.4% with a typical mileage of 80,470 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Tiguan f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 7,258 recorded failures. If you're considering buying PN10 ZST,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Tiguan typ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 16 years old, this Volkswagen Tiguan is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
